Was born on August 29, 1976 in Baku, in the Caucasus, a brother to Ilana and Emil, a handsome and handsome child with a charming smile, a good and disciplined boy. He studied at the Givon Elementary School in Tel Hanan, and was a diligent and intelligent child, who invested in his studies and performed the tasks he was assigned in the right way and in the best way possible. Even before he was nine years old, the father of the family died and left the mother, Raya, with three young children. He liked to play football, volleyball and basketball, and was a fan of Maccabi Haifa. At the end of November 1994, Ruslan joined the IDF. He dreamed of serving a combat service in the Golani Brigade and contributing to the state, and succeeded in convincing his mother to sign an agreement to enlist him in a combat unit. Upon his induction, he was assigned to the ‘Gideon’ battalion in the Golani Brigade. Ruslan was very fond of serving in the IDF, and was very proud to be a combat soldier in Golani, and his commanders saw him as a dedicated soldier and an excellent fighter who volunteered first for every mission and performed his duties diligently. On September 14, 1997, when a Golani force returned from ambush in the central sector of the security zone in south Lebanon, a roadside bomb exploded, killing Ruslan, who was a sharp fighter in the platoon. The tour was accompanied by Staff Sergeant Ofir Bassol. Ruslan was laid to rest at the military cemetery in Haifa and is twenty-one years old. Survived by mother, sister and brother.
